Field Notes

Description:

Wingspan: 38 mm.

Habitat:

Mixed forests consisting mainly of bamboo, cherry, pines, etc. Cool to warm place. Altitude: 1,700 m.

Notes:

Unlike those on Plutodes flavescens, the dark prominent patches on this one's wings are not well demarcated.
